Erling Xoland said the World Cup changed his outlook on life

Manchester City striker and Norway national team forward Erling Haaland shared his thoughts on his participation in the recently concluded World Cup, Zamin.uz reports.
Although the Norwegian national team bowed out of the tournament in the quarter-finals after a loss to England, the striker emphasized that this tournament completely changed his life and worldview. According to Goal.com, the footballer did not hide his immense pride in his national team’s success on the international stage.
For the Norway national team, this match became a true test. Over the course of six weeks on the fields of the United States, the Scandinavian players not only achieved positive results but also won the hearts of many fans with their meaningful performances.
In an interview with local media, Erling Haaland described this period as the most exciting forty days of his life and admitted that words fail to capture the emotions he felt during that time. According to him, participating in such a major tournament is the dream of every footballer.
During the tournament, the Norway national team defeated Brazil, stunning the world of football. However, for Haaland, there were more important achievements than just on-field results.
In his view, the team brought Norway back onto the world football map and united the entire nation around a common goal. According to reports, more than twenty thousand fans gathered with great enthusiasm in front of the Royal Palace in Oslo to watch the quarter-final match.
The striker stressed that while defeating Brazil was important, introducing his country to the world was an even greater honor. Norway’s quarter-final match against England ended in a hard and dramatic fashion.
Erling Haaland also reflected on certain referee decisions during the match. In particular, he recalled the controversial moments that arose when the score was level, as well as the shots that hit the crossbar.
The footballer emphasized that it was precisely these small details that determined the fate of the match. Nevertheless, he expressed pride in his team and said this experience will help them become stronger in the future.
